Discussion on therapeutic mechanism of total flavonoids of Pterocarya Hupehensis Skan on rheumatoid arthritis based on Fas/FasL mediated mitochondrial apoptosis
Objective:To explore the possible mechanism of total flavonoids of Pterocarya Hupehensis Skan(PHSTF)in the treatment of rheumatoid arthritis(RA)through Fas/FasL mediated mitochondrial apoptosis.Methods:Collagen induced arthritis(CIA)-fibroblast synovial cells(FLS)cells were cultured in vitro,and the effect of PHSTF on cell survival rate was detected by CCK-8;The effect of PHSTF on cell apoptosis was detected by flow cytometry;Fas,FasL,Bax,Bcl-2,t-Bid,C-Caspase8,C-Caspase9,C-Caspase3 protein expression was detected by Western Blot.The effect of PHSTF on the expression of related proteins was further tested after adding the Fas inhibitor KR-33493.In vivo experiment using type Ⅱ collagen induction method to construct CIA rat replicated RA model.Establish control group,model group,PHSTF group,and TG group with 8 rats in each group.The AI index and toe swelling degree of each group were evaluated;and the TNF-α,IL-1β,IL-6 in serum was detected by ELISA.The pathological changes of the knee joint were observed through HE staining.The expression of mitochondrial apoptosis related proteins mediated by Fas/FasL in synovial tissue was detected through Western Blot.Results:In vitro experiments had shown that PHSTF could significantly induce apoptosis in CIA-FLS cells(P<0.0l).Compared with the control group,the expression of Fas,FasL,Bax,t-Bid,C-Caspase8,C-Caspase9,and C-Caspase3 proteins was increased in all concentration groups of PHSTF,while the expression of anti apoptotic protein Bcl-2 was significantly reduced(P<0.05,P<0.01).After adding the Fas inhibitor KR-33493 to interfere with the Fas signaling pathway,it reversed the expression of Fas signaling pathway related proteins.In vivo experiments showed that compared with the model group,the AI score and toe swelling of the PHSTF and TG groups were significantly reduced(P<0.05),the pathological changes of the knee joint were improved,and the the level of TNF-α,IL-1β,IL-6 in serum was significantly reduced(P<0.01).The expression of Fas,FasL,Bax,t-Bid,C-Caspase8,C-Caspase9,and C-Caspase3 proteins was increased,while the expression of Bcl-2 protein was significantly reduced(P<0.01).Conclusion:PHSTF can activate Fas/FasL mediated mitochondrial apoptosis,inhibit CIA-FLS cell proliferation,promote apoptosis,improve CIA rat arthritis phenotype,and play a therapeutic role in RA.
